pri_num

N/A

N/A

Priority value of the message, a combination of the facility value and the severity value of the message. Priority value = (facility value * 8) + severity value.
The facility code valid options are:
LOCAL0 (Code = 16)
LOCAL1 (Code = 17)
LOCAL2 (Code = 18)
LOCAL3 (Code = 19)
LOCAL4 (Code = 20)
LOCAL5 (Code = 21)
LOCAL6 (Code = 22; default)
LOCAL7 (Code = 23)

msg_id

N/A

N/A

Unique message ID; 1 to 4294967295. The message ID increases by 1 with each new message. Message IDs restart at 1 each time the application is restarted.

total_seg

N/A

N/A

Total number of segments in a log message. Long messages are divided into more than one segment.
Note : The total_seg depends on the Maximum Length setting in the remote logging targets page. See Remote Logging Target Settings.

seg_num

N/A

N/A

Segment sequence number within a message. Use this number to determine what segment of the message you are viewing.

timestamp

N/A

N/A

Date of the message generation, according to the local clock of the originating the Cisco ISE node, in the following format :
YYYY-MM-DD hh:mm:ss:xxx +/-zh:zm.

sequence_num

N/A

N/A

Global counter of each message. If one message is sent to the local store and the next to the syslog server target, the counter increments by 2. Possible values are 0000000001 to 999999999.
